Title: A Novel Timing Estimation Method for OFDM under Multipath Fading Channels
Source: Proceedings of 2010 Cross-Strait Conference on Information Science and Technology (CSCIST 2010 E-BOOK) (pp 320-322)
Author(s): Junhui Zhao, School of Electronics and Information Engineering, Beijing Jiaotong University, Beijing
Abstract: In the multipath channels, determining the first path is one of the key steps, but most previous methods assumed the strongest path as the first path, this makes the timing delay and introduces serious ISI (Inter Symbol Interference). A novel algorithm based on the timing synchronization algorithm using PN sequence is proposed in this paper. The timing of the first path is determined by detecting the first falling edge of the moving summation of the correlation result. Simulation results show that the performance of the new scheme is much better than the conventional synchronization algorithms in multipath environment.
